How much do quality inspector 2nd shift j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 11, 2026, the average hourly pay for quality inspector 2nd shift in Arizona is $19.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.00 and $21.49 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the quality inspector 2nd shift position?

To thrive as a Quality Inspector 2Nd Shift, you need attention to detail, knowledge of quality assurance procedures, and a high school diploma or equivalent, with prior experience in manufacturing or inspection preferred. Familiarity with measurement tools like calipers, micrometers, and gauges, and proficiency in quality management systems (QMS) or statistical process control (SPC) software is essential. Effective communication, reliability, and teamwork are standout soft skills for this position. These skills are vital for ensuring products consistently meet quality standards during off-hour shifts and for maintaining smooth production operations.

What is a quality inspector 2nd shift?

A Quality Inspector on the 2nd shift is responsible for inspecting products and materials to ensure they meet quality standards and specifications. They typically work during the evening shift, examining production processes, conducting tests, and documenting findings. Their role helps maintain product consistency, identify defects, and support compliance with company and industry regulations.

What are the typical work hours and team dynamics for a quality inspector 2nd shift?

Quality Inspectors working the 2nd shift typically work afternoon to evening hours, often from around 2 PM to 10 PM, though exact times can vary by employer. You will usually be part of a quality assurance team and collaborate closely with production staff, supervisors, and sometimes maintenance teams to ensure quality standards are met throughout the shift. The 2nd shift often handles production overflow from earlier shifts and prepares lines for the following day, so teamwork and communication with other shifts are key. While the pace can be steady, being responsive and proactive about identifying potential issues is expected. This role offers valuable experience and visibility that can lead to advancement within quality assurance or production management.

Quality Inspector (Second Shift)

Latitude Corp.

Tucson, AZ • On-site

Full-time, Other

Life, Retirement

Re-posted 18 days ago


Job description

Latitude Corp.


We are looking for a Quality Inspector 1 to join our 100% EMPLOYEE-OWNED team.

Latitude Corp. offers challenging and rewarding career opportunities in precision metal manufacturing where we make the impossible possible.We embrace problem solvers, creativity and innovation.With clean, climate-controlled facilities, we offer comfortable working environments. Our customers span a variety of industries, including US military and defense.We are proud of the work we do and we believe that our employees are the key to our success. That's why we're committed to providing our team with the support, resources, and opportunities they need to succeed.

Minimum Job Requirements

  • Physical- Capable of lifting 50 lbs. safely or with assistance. Capability of standing and bending over for long periods of time while performing manual labor with or without reasonable accommodations.
  • Working Hours- Fulltime employment (40+ hours/week)
  • Personal Traits- Good communication skills with positive teamwork attitude. Conscientious attention to detail and accuracy. Ability to follow direction and or work independently, able to multi-task and trouble shoot.
  • Punctuality and safe work habits.
  • Be an example of safety and quality for other production employees.

Job Duties and Responsibilities

  • Work safely and ensure hazardous conditions are eliminated. Follow company safety procedures.
  • Ensure the highest quality standards are met with all work done.
  • Understand Quality / Safety Policy and Objectives.
  • Ensure output meets required deadlines while executing above.
  • Act as a liaison between Quality and Production departments. Ensure cross departmental communication is accurate and effective.
  • Final inspection and packaging of parts prior to delivery to customer.
  • Complete daily checklists on designated equipment and maintain records.
  • Accurately maintain MES system as instructed.
  • Arrive to work in a punctual manner and be willing to work overtime when needed.
  • Assist in monthly inventory process.
  • Maintain neat and clean work area.
  • Other ad hoc duties as assigned.

Knowledge, Skills and Abilities

  • Must be able to visually inspect parts with high attention to detail.
  • Ability to differentiate between different parts and materials.
  • Possess basic math, reading, and computer skills.

Education and Experience

  • High school diploma or equivalent experience.
  • At least one (1) year manufacturing experience
  • At least one (1) year quality experience
